Output d130e696586e7aa7d5c4eeff338113f8c3d25d37c117c20ebb87b4f4d94ff4dd:1

value
2648640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0a137e013a4cb58e46b1a6eb873a9b4208e609 OP_EQUAL
address
3HeYFDX68Sr5DiHUkgxqv53fWwRizyNsKD
transaction
d130e696586e7aa7d5c4eeff338113f8c3d25d37c117c20ebb87b4f4d94ff4dd
confirmations
376520
spent
true